Completion of Main Line of Road FROM The Lakes to Dunedin. ryHE PUNTS AT THE ARROW & NEVIS FERRIES, Kawarau River, are NOW OPEN for Horsemen and Dray Traffic, which can now travel without interruption by a good road between the Lakes and Dunedin.
